GOBOLI GOOSHT BANDAR ABBAS

Goboli Goosht is one of the famous dishes of Hormozgan, full of special fragrant spices, whose smell spreads everywhere. Cooked, suited meat, fried potatoes, cooked chickpea, golden onions, and rice, cooked with broth and various spices such as cardamom, cloves, dried lemon, southern spices and pepper are the ingredients of this delicious Goboli. Some cook it with chicken and some add raisins too.

Goboli polo is a kind of pilaf or steamed rice, cooked with broth. This pilaf is a type of mix pilaf combined and served with meat, chickpea, potatoes, and raisins and is so delicious. It is good to know that chickpea increases its nutritional value. Since the rice is cooked with broth, it absorbs all the taste and properties of the meat. Side dishes can be mixed with rice or be separately, depending on taste.

Ingredients for Goboli Goosht for 4 people:

Rice: 4 cups

Mutton: 250 grams

Onions: 2pcs

Potatoes: 2 pcs

chickpea: 1 cup

Tomato paste: 1 tablespoon

Raisins: ½ cup

Cinnamon stick: 1 pc

Dried lemon powder: ½ teaspoon

Pilaf spice: 1 tablespoon

Salt and pepper: as needed

Turmeric and oil: as needed

Goboli Polo Recipe:
Step 1

To have a great delicious Goboli Polo, first wash and peel the onions. Then take a pot and heat it with a little oil. Now sauté sliced onions in oil until they become light and golden.

Step 2

Add the meat and sauté until its color changes. Then add black pepper and turmeric and keep heating until you feel the aroma. Then add cinnamon stick and a little water until it cooks well.

Step 3

Add salt at the end of cooking. When the meat is fully cooked, strain the broth. Add cardamom, black pepper, pilaf spice and dried lemon to the broth and let it come to boil. Wash the rice and soak in salt water.

Step 4

When the broth boils, strain the rice and add it the broth. Add enough water to cover the rice as the size of a knuckle. When the water almost evaporates, add a little butter to the rice and then wash and peel the potatoes.

Step 5

At this step, dice the potatoes. Take a pan and heat it with a little oil until the oil is hot. Fry the potatoes and take them out.

Step 6

At this step, cut another onion into medium slices, fry it, and remove from the pan. Chop the meat and sauté it in the same pan. Cook the soaked chickpea with a little water.

Step 7

Sauté the meat with some dried lemon powder, salt and a little tomato paste. Add washed raisins, sauté a bit and remove from the heat. Put the meat, chickpea, raisins, potato and golden onion mixture on the rice. If you want, you can add cardamom and clove powder on the rice. Be sure to try this delicious Hormozgani dish and enjoy.
